fixin(g) to do something Rur. getting ready to do something; getting ready to start something. I'm fixin' to go to the store. Need anything? with all the fixin's (or fixings) Rur. with all the condiments or other dishes that accompany a certain kind of food. For $12.99 you get a turkey dinner with all the fixings.
